ENG 200 Reading and Composition (3 units)
Section 0324 Class Begins August 18
Course Description
Critical reading and writing based on the study of selected rhetorical examples. Emphasis is placed on expository and argumentative writing styles. Methods of development for the college level research paper.
Prerequisite: English 80 or qualification for English 200 through the assessment process
